Kyle Chang is a scholar working on Biophysics, Molecular Biology and Orthopedics and Sports Medicine. According to data from OpenAlex, Kyle Chang has authored 6 papers receiving a total of 426 indexed citations (citations by other indexed papers that have themselves been cited), including 5 papers in Biophysics, 2 papers in Molecular Biology and 2 papers in Orthopedics and Sports Medicine. Recurrent topics in Kyle Chang’s work include Electromagnetic Fields and Biological Effects (5 papers), Bone health and osteoporosis research (2 papers) and Bone Metabolism and Diseases (1 paper). Kyle Chang is often cited by papers focused on Electromagnetic Fields and Biological Effects (5 papers), Bone health and osteoporosis research (2 papers) and Bone Metabolism and Diseases (1 paper). Kyle Chang collaborates with scholars based in Taiwan. Kyle Chang's co-authors include Walter Chang, Chung Shih, Walter Hong‐Shong Chang, Sherry Huang, Meiling Wu and Ming-Tzu Tsai and has published in prestigious journals such as Journal of Orthopaedic Research®, Connective Tissue Research and Bioelectromagnetics.
